Nairobi — Samburu Game
Reserve
This morning we travel
by road to Kenya's northern frontier. Wild and rugged,
Samburu is fiercely beautiful with its arid savannahs
watered by the lovely Uaso Nyiro River. It is also
one of Kenya's most protected areas and home to species
only found north of the equator, from the reticulated
giraffe to Grevy's zebras and Beisa oryxes. We also
enjoy Larsens Tented Camp or Samburu Intrepids Camp,
our luxurious tents set beneath a canopy of acacia
trees along the banks of the river.

Day 6
Laikipia — Lake
Nakuru National Park
Returning back to the Sabuk lodge
just after sunrise and a hearty bush breakfast we
then depart and drive down the escarpments and across
to the Rift Valley, arriving at Lion Hill in time
for lunch. World famous for its millions of shimmering
pink flamingoes; Lake Nakuru is an ornithologists'
Mecca. Flotillas of Pelicans swimming by, hundreds
of storks, herons and egrets add to this natural menagerie
of colour. The park is also one of the few reserves
left where one can see both Black & White Rhinos
in the wild. Together with lurking Lions, Giraffes
and Leopards, Lake Nakuru provides excellent game
viewing amongst the 'yellow barked acacia forests'.
